Voka, born 1965, lives and works in the Lower Austrian town of Puchberg am Schneeberg. He coined the term "Spontaneous Realism" as a trademark for his art. Voka defines this style as a revival of the significance of contemporary art, a valued tradition in a new era, with a new interpretation reflecting today ́s spirit of the time. His distinctive style, emerging from the dynamic of the moment, enables him to strikingly capture immediate reality while the observer is able to palpably feel the imbedded movement. His ability to create one of his paintings in a short space of time and with great dynamic, he explained in a very simple way ́I have dealt with painting for a very, very long time in a very slowly and intensively way.`
The basis of his artistic creations is rooted in a decade-long altercation with the art of realism. He researched the technique of the old masters and appropriated them into his own intensive self-study. It was his first contact with watercolour that made him realise that working quickly - which he was almost forced to do when working outside as the colours dry so quickly - could give his stroke more momentum and therefore enormous dynamic. With the discovery of acrylic he was able to allow his solid basic knowledge of, not only the meticulousness and `heavy`art of oil painting but also the `light`and rapid technique of watercolour painting, to flow together to discover and develop his own style of Spontaneous Realism.
If you look in a dictionary for the word spontaneous you will find definitions like, "rising from a momentary impulse without conscious reflection", or, "not apparently contrived or anipulated: natural" or "often surprising for the surrounding environment". Looking at Voka's paintings from this vantage point, makes this newly created expression a more than meaningful description of his work. If one has the opportunity or chance to watch the painter while he is in the act of creating his work, and see - or better, experience - the immediacy, vigor and enthusiasm with which Voka creates his paintings, then this simple expression, spontaneous realism, conveys a defining emotion. And this is exactly the moment where his art begins. Voka's inspirations are the everyday events of daily life, the seemingly hidden, though omnipresent.
"The motif is not the deciding factor for me, but rather my motivation behind it."He tries to capture with his paintings, snapshot-like, the things that touch him, whatever the reason for it might be.The basis of Voka's artistic abilities is rooted in his longstanding creative challenge with the art of realism. This intimate knowledge combined with his technical skills and artistic talent enables him to react spontaneously to the unforeseen. Only those who know the entiretycan reduce it to the essence. It is for Voka like a walk through memory lane, wherein he modifies his memories, intensifies them and arranges them anew until they transform into somethingconcrete. This could be rays of light, a group of people or an inspiring color accent in a specific location. Everything else serves only as a frame that helps accentuate the main theme. Voka's hands are dancing so fast over the canvas that it almost seems like he puts himself under pressure. An imaginary race begins in which the thought competes with the actual act of painting. It is an interplay in which the idea is just a breath ahead of the brush stroke. "Every painting is an impulsive challenge that starts with a first idea and ends with the final brush stroke, and each brush stroke decides over victory or defeat."What attracts Voka is the depiction of the unforeseen.He calls it also a dialogue with colors where pure chance always has a right to answer, too."If I knew in advance how the finished painting would look, it would be too boring to paint it in the first place."
